I moved to NYC on August 15th, 2001. After a couple of weeks I got a job as an Assistant Creative at Lowe Lintas Worldwide in Dag Hammarskjöld Plaza on East 47th street. My first day of work was 9/11.

I knew who I was before I moved to NYC, but like most early 20-somethings I was still in the process of figuring out who I wanted to be. That day changed me forever. How I saw the world. How I processed the importance of things. How my heart was broken and filled simultaneously. It was wildly confusing and enlightening all at once.

I’ve always had an insatiable need for color in my life. Not just color though, VIBRANT color. Color with passion. Color with humor. Color with meaning. That day was as contradictory as every emotion that was running through me. It was the most beautiful, sunny, bright blue clear sky day. And then the black darkness came. I will truly, never forget.

Painting is the most honest and significant way that I have been able to dig into my life and express my own personal contradictions of varying levels of intensity: of love and anger, hope and disappointment, joy and frustration, pain and humor. With every stroke, I am making a statement, even if I don’t always have the words to verbalize it. The one unmistakable thread of consistency throughout each piece is the obsessive use of colors.
